    Royal Astronomical Society Postage Stamp

    From the album: Personal Gallery Of Fred Ley

    This postage stamp was issued in 1970 to commemorate the 150th anniversarry of the founding of the Royal Astronical Society. Depicted on the stamp, from left to right, are three individuals who were influential in the founding of the Society. They are, Sir William Herschel, at left, the first President, holding his famous drawing of Uranus and two satellites; Francis Baily, of Baily's Beads fame; and John Herschel, William's son. In the background is the 48-inch Newtonian that Herschel had at his home in Slough, England.
